    Armored Core 6: Prisoner Rescue Battle Log Location

    The Prisoner Rescue Battle Log in Armored Core 6 can be a bit challenging to find. You could easily miss it if you don’t know exactly where to look. You don’t want to restart the level looking for it all over again, we made this guide to help you find the Prisoner Rescue Battle Log so you’ll know exactly where it is.

    Where to Find the Prisoner Rescue Battle Log in Armored Core 6?

    The Prisoner Rescue Battle Log can only be found on a New Game++, which is your third playthrough. You can get the Battle Log by defeating a Tetrapod miniboss called Deep Down/Nile, who can be encountered near the end of the Prisoner Rescue mission. It’s the 9th mission, exclusively available only to New Game++ and not anywhere else.

    There is only one battle log in Prisoner Rescue, so you don’t need to worry once you’ve found it. Simply continue the mission until the RLF helicopter pilot lands at Site A. Handler Walker will then ask you to clear the area. Head to the left of the landing zone, and you’ll spot the Tetrapod mech that you need to beat to get the combat log.

    The Tetrapod miniboss itself isn’t a particularly tough fight, but it does have strong stun damage. Beating it to get its combat log is highly worth it since the Loghunt Program rewards you get from collecting battle logs let you create some of the best builds in the game.

    Because of how Armored Core 6 missions are structured, some missions are only available during the New Game+ and New Game++ modes. If you want access to these missions, you’ll have to start the game in these modes. The Prisoner Rescue mission that holds the battle log you’re looking for is only available in New Game++, which is unlocked after beating New Game+ mode.
